Office move notes, Tuesday stand-up: The Kestrelwood team confirmed the new floor at Harbourgate is ready from Monday. Desks and crates go first; archive cabinets follow Wednesday. Freya will label everything by Friday. For the sensitive HR files going separately by courier, make sure the driver gets this exact hand-over instruction:

dispatch memo: the eliok quenok courier leaves the sorael aldath belion tammir casix gileth queniel jorath ledger at gate 9299 under passcode 897989

Document Transport — Print Shop Master Copies

Quick guide for moving master copies to Bramblehurst Print Co. These are the only originals, so treat the run like a valuables transfer, not a regular parcel drop. Use the red tamper-evident envelopes from the supply shelf, log the seal number in the transport book, and never combine the run with general mail. The masters go directly to the press supervisor, nobody else. On arrival, the courier must follow the hand-over instruction stated below.

drop instructions, kajep-tageg: the kasvan casdor courier leaves the quenvan quenox druox ledger at gate 4316 under passcode 799004

Subject: Feedcheck cut-over summary

The podcast feed validator is now running on the new Feedcheck service as of this morning. All feeds from the Larkspool network validate through it; the legacy checker is read-only and will be retired next sprint. Error rates match baseline. For your review, the active configuration is reproduced below.

deployment values, kagap-hahif:
[queneth]
port = 5672
region = south-4
host = queneth.qirvantech.local
team = istir
timeout_ms = 1500
retries = 2

Runbook: Account Recovery during Checkout Load Tests

When the Marlowe load harness runs against the checkout flow, synthetic accounts occasionally trip the lockout threshold and require recovery. Do not raise the threshold; it mirrors production. Instead, recover locked synthetic accounts through the staging recovery console, which bypasses email verification for the test tenant only. Access to that console is gated, and the gate accepts the recovery passphrase below.

vault phrase of bafop-kahop = sormir-frador